About Everdan Carneiro

Everdan Carneiro is a scholar working on Oral Surgery, Medical Laboratory Technology and Orthodontics, having authored 71 papers that have together received 970 indexed citations. Recurring topics across this work include Endodontics and Root Canal Treatments (47 papers), Dental Radiography and Imaging (42 papers), Dental Trauma and Treatments (17 papers), Dental materials and restorations (12 papers), dental development and anomalies (7 papers), Oral microbiology and periodontitis research (7 papers), Injury Epidemiology and Prevention (6 papers) and Occupational health in dentistry (6 papers). The work is most often cited by research in Oral Surgery (701 citations), Medical Laboratory Technology (109 citations) and Orthodontics (186 citations). Everdan Carneiro has collaborated with scholars based in Brazil, United States and Italy. Frequent co-authors include Ulisses Xavier da Silva Neto, Vânia Portela Ditzel Westphalen, Luíz Fernando Fariniuk, Lucila Piasecki, Ariadne Letra, Clóvis Monteiro Bramante, Renato Menezes, José Mauro Granjeiro, Alessandro Dourado Loguércio and R Holland.
